Exercise 14-6A (Algo) Working capital and current ratio LO 14-2 On June 30, Year 3, Perez Company's total current assets were $501,000 and its total current liabilities were $279,500. On July 1 Year 3. Perez issued a short-term note to a bank for $40,200 cash. Required a. Compute Perez's working capital before and after issuing the note. b. Compute Perez's current ratio before and after issuing the note. (Round your answers to 2 decimal places.) Working capital b. Current ratio Before the Transaction After the Transaction
